Alumni’s collection featured on Vogue

Domus Academy is proud of its alumni Reid Baker and Ines Amorim whose Autumn/Winter and Spring/Summer 2019/20 collections have been featured on the Vogue.it talents section.
Reid Baker and Ines Amorim founded the brand Ernest W. Baker in 2017, after meeting at Domus Academy while they were both attending the Master’s in Fashion Design.
The brand draws on the charming lifestyle of Reid Baker’s Grandfather, Mr. Ernest W. Baker, bringing into life collections that combine the allure of vintage with contemporary trends.
The Autumn/Winter collection is inspired by office workers in Detroit during the 70’s and 80’s.
The Spring/Summer collection is influenced by the photographic series ‘Suburbia’ by Bill Owens and by ‘The Truman Show’ by Peter Weir.
